Explanations: P - pull off
H - hammer on
B - bend
R - release bend
/ - slide up
\ - slide down
^ - upstroke (the pick moves towards the sky. "Pull")
v - downstroke (the pick moves towards the ground. "Push")

BE CAREFUL WITH THE STROKE DIRECTION!!!
